What are some new moon rituals?

It could be as simple as meditating, taking a yoga class, or writing a list. Or, it can be as elaborate as creating a space, making a crystal grid, taking a cleanse bath or smudging your entire apartment. Whatever it is, make sure it incorporates taking a moment to reflect and plant a few seeds of intention.

What are positive rituals?

Most positive rituals are concerned with consecrating or renewing an object or an individual, and negative rituals are always in relation to positive ritual behaviour. Rituals of avoidance also depend upon the belief system of a community and the ritual status of the individuals in their relation to each other. What are sacred rituals? A ritual is a ceremony or action performed in a customary way. As an adjective, ritual means "conforming to religious rites," which are the sacred, customary ways of celebrating a religion or culture. Different communities have different ritual practices, like meditation in Buddhism, or baptism in Christianity.
